0

我有一个核心数据实体,它有两个名称属性和几个其他数字属性。排序首先在数字属性上,最后在名称属性上。数据来自多个来源,因此可能会得到按顺序切换名称的重复行。即第1 行有名字Bill 和Ed,其中第2 行有名字Ed 和Bill。这些行是相同的,只是名称的顺序被交换了。

我希望可能有一种方法可以“隐藏”表视图中的重复行,但由于行数来自 fetchedresults 控制器,我看不出它是如何工作的。

关于如何进行的任何建议?

吉姆

4

1 回答 1

0

我认为最好的方法是创建一个包含您实际想要显示的所有数据的数组。您可以将您的第一个源分配给数组,而对于其他源,您首先验证该项目不存在,然后再添加它。如果您知道如何呈现重复项,那么您可以编写在将其添加到数组之前需要传递的必要条件。

于 2013-07-18T01:41:27.953 回答